Use as a stationary machine
(Fig. 1)
The product must be mounted on a workbench for
continuous use.
• The product must be securely installed, i.e. bolted
down on a workbench or fixed machine stand.
• There are fixing holes in the foot (9) for this pur-
pose.
1. Mark the drill holes.
– Place the product as it will be installed later.
– Mark the positions of the holes to be drilled on
the workbench.
These are predetermined by the holes in the
foot (9).
Installation close to the edge is recommended.
2. Drill the holes (at least 6.5 mm diameter) through
the workbench.
3. Place the product over the drilled holes congruent
with the holes in the foot (9) and insert suitable
screws* through the holes from above and tighten
them.

Extraction port set (16) (Fig. 2)
The product is equipped with an extraction port.
The extraction port set (16) has a diameter of 40 mm.
Connect a dust extractor when processing dusty mate-
rials.
ATTENTION
The dust extraction system must be suitable for the
material to be processed.
Use a special extraction device to extract particularly
harmful or carcinogenic dusts.
1. Connect the hose of a suitable dust extraction sys-
tem* (e.g. industrial hoover) directly to the ex-
traction port set (16).

10 Operation
ATTENTION
Always make sure the product is fully assembled
before commissioning!
Note:
The product is equipped with a safety switch. This
means that the product cannot be switched on if the
doors are open or have not been closed properly.
Make sure that both safety switches (11a) engage
properly on the housing doors (11).
WARNING
Danger of injury!
The on/off switch and the safety switch must not be
locked!
–
Do not work with the product if the switches are
damaged.
–
Make sure the product is in working order before
each use.
WARNING
Always make sure that the tool attachment is fitted
correctly!
WARNING
Make sure that the tool attachment is suitable for the
material to be processed.
Note:
The product must be mounted on a workbench for
continuous use.
• Let the tool attachment reach full speed before
processing the workpiece.
• Select a tool attachment that corresponds to the
material to be processed.
• The saw table must be mounted correctly.
• Place the product in a stable location.
• Prior to commissioning, all covers and safety devic-
es must be mounted correctly. Damaged or illegible
stickers must be replaced.
